    One standalone tool reported generating over 62,000 text match cut videos in a single week. That number belongs to a free browser tool built around exactly one effect, nothing else, and it’s still climbing.

    A text match cut is the rapid-fire style where the same word stays locked in the same spot on screen while everything around it changes, the visual rhythm you’ve seen in countless documentary-style TikTok edits. It reads as high-production editing even though the actual process takes under thirty seconds once you know what you’re doing.

    What a Text Match Cut Actually Is

    A text match cut locks one word or short phrase in a fixed screen position while the background, font, or scene rapidly changes around it. The effect first became known through documentary editing techniques, then spread into short-form social content once creators realized how well it captures attention in a silent, fast scroll.

    The visual logic matters more than the software behind it. Viewers register the repeated word as an anchor point, which makes a fast cut sequence feel readable instead of chaotic.

    Is This Actually an AI Tool?

    Direct answer: mostly no, and that’s worth being honest about. Several of the leading text match cut tools, including TextMatchCut itself, openly state they don’t run heavy AI models to produce the effect. The “AI-era” label describes the design philosophy, instant, no signup, browser-based, rather than genuine machine learning doing the creative work.

    That honesty matters more than it sounds. A tool relying on template logic instead of a trained model can be faster and more reliable, not less impressive. For a business deciding what to use, how the tool works matters less than whether the output looks right and exports cleanly.

    The 3-Second Hook Framework

    The 3-Second Hook Framework describes exactly what a text match cut needs to accomplish in a short-form ad. Second one anchors the word or number that matters most. Second two delivers the cut sequence that holds attention through motion. Second three lands on a clear next action or the product itself. Every effective text match cut ad follows some version of this same three-beat structure.

    Anchor, Cut, Land

    Skipping the anchor beat produces a video that feels fast but meaningless, since the viewer never registers what’s actually being emphasized. Skipping the land beat wastes the attention the first two seconds just earned. The 3-Second Hook Framework works because it forces every match cut to justify its own existence with a clear payoff.

    How to Build One Without Overthinking It

    Direct answer: pick one number, price, or word that matters most to your offer, type it into a text match cut tool, choose a vertical export, and download, a process that takes under a minute once you know your anchor word.

    Step 1: Pick Your Anchor Word First

    Choose the single word or short number your entire message hinges on, a price, a percentage, a product name. Everything else in the video exists to support this one anchor.

    Step 2: Keep the Phrase Short

    Most tools cap focal text around twenty to twenty five characters. Longer phrases lose the punch that makes this effect work in the first place.

    Step 3: Choose the Right Aspect Ratio

    Vertical 9:16 covers TikTok, Reels, and Shorts. Square 1:1 works better for feed posts. Match the format to wherever the video will actually run.

    Step 4: Add Sound Sparingly

    A simple paper shuffle, camera shutter, or flash pop sound cue reinforces the cut rhythm without needing a full soundtrack.

    Step 5: Export and Reuse the Template

    Once one version works, the same anchor-cut-land structure applies to your next product, price, or announcement without starting from scratch.

    Frequently Asked Questions

    Is a text match cut hard to make without editing experience?

    No. Every tool covered here works through a simple type-and-generate interface, with no manual keyframing or timeline editing required to get a usable result.

    Can I use a text match cut video for a paid ad?

    Yes. Every tool reviewed here explicitly permits commercial use of the videos you generate, including client work and branded content.

    What’s the difference between a text match cut and a paper animator effect?

    A text match cut focuses purely on rapid text-anchored cuts. A paper animator effect adds a torn paper texture and fold motion to a photo. Some tools, including PaperAnimators.in, offer both under one roof.
